Subject Description

An introduction to the cultural study of the German nation. Students will have gained an understanding of the cultural, intellectual and social framework that shaped Germany in the period 1871 to 1945. They will have been introduced to a range of seminal 19th and 20th-century German texts of a political, literary and social nature which cast light on Germany's emergence as a 'cultural nation' and thereby encountered different interpretative approaches to cultural studies in German. No knowledge of the German language required.
